This paper presents a system for hearbeat detection using microwave Doppler technique. Using a vector network analyzer, a microwave system is tested for the detection of the heartbeat signal at a distance of 1 feet from a person. This paper presents the overall design of Home Automation System (HAS) with low cost and wireless remote control. This system is designed to assist and provide support in order to fulfil the needs of elderly and disabled in home. Also, the smart home concept in the system improves the standard living at home. In this paper, presented an array of 2 × 2 UWB Bowtie antennas for Ultra Wide Band (UWB) mobile communication is being proposed. The antenna designs have been simulated using CST Microwave Studio. The antenna covers the UWB spectrum from 4.0 to 10.6 GHz, and had a return loss below than 10 dB throughout the entire band. A compact antenna area of 56.4 × 76.0 mm2 is obtained. Based on the block-matching motion vector estimation techniques, a grid system using the block-based technique is proposed for motion tracking in video sequences. The technique is known as hexagon-diamond grid system (HDGS). The HDGS has a large hexagon and small diamond search pattern based on block-matching motion tracking characteristics.
